You add the mixture to make teriyaki sauce including: 20ml soy sauce, 110gr brown sugar into a bowl and stir well.
Then add 7.5gr minced ginger, 5gr minced garlic, 15ml honey, 15ml sesame oil, and 45ml Mirin into the bowl and stir well.
Pour the teriyaki sauce mixture into a pot and bring to a boil. When the teriyaki sauce boils, reduce the heat and simmer for about 4 minutes until the sauce thickens.
Remove the pot from the stove and let the teriyaki sauce cool to complete.
Note: When the teriyaki sauce has completely cooled, pour it into jars with tight lids and store it in the refrigerator for long-term use.
Wash the salmon fillet thoroughly, crush or blend some ginger and mix it with a little white wine, then massage the salmon evenly, marinate for about 5 – 10 minutes and then rinse with water. After that, pat the salmon dry.
Tips for Cleaning Salmon, No Fishy Smell
Place the salmon on a plate and sprinkle a little salt and pepper on top, then use your hands to rub the seasoning evenly for 3 minutes so that the salmon fillet absorbs the flavor.
Grilled salmon fillet with Teriyaki sauce is an incredibly delicious and attractive dish. The fish is crispy on the outside and tender on the inside, combined with the special Teriyaki sauce from Japan, creating a unique flavor.

Salmon fillet 300 gr Teriyaki sauce 3 tablespoons French fries 200 gr (optional) Lemon 1/2 piece Salt a little
Rinse the salmon fillet with diluted salt water. Then, soak the salmon fillet in diluted lemon water for about 2 – 3 minutes to eliminate the fishy smell, then remove and let it drain.
To prepare for the next step, use paper towels to lightly pat the water off the fish, then cut it into bite-sized pieces.
Place a non-stick pan on the stove. Wait for the pan to heat, then add the salmon fillet and grill on medium-low heat for about 3 minutes; at this point, the salmon will release its fat, so no additional oil is needed!
Next, turn the fish over so both sides become golden and crispy, then reduce the heat, add 3 tablespoons of teriyaki sauce, and gently stir for about 3 – 4 minutes. When the sauce thickens slightly, taste and adjust the seasoning if necessary, then turn off the heat.
You just need to arrange the salmon on a plate, serve with sautéed or mashed potatoes and enjoy while it’s still hot for a more complete flavor of the dish!
